DequeEnumerator<TValue> Třída

Definice

Podporuje jednoduchou iteraci přes libovolný objekt STL/CLR, který implementuje IDeque<TValue> rozhraní.

generic <typename TValue>
public ref class DequeEnumerator : Microsoft::VisualC::StlClr::DequeEnumeratorBase<TValue>, System::Collections::Generic::IEnumerator<TValue>
public class DequeEnumerator<TValue> : Microsoft.VisualC.StlClr.DequeEnumeratorBase<TValue>, System.Collections.Generic.IEnumerator<TValue>
type DequeEnumerator<'Value> = class
    inherit DequeEnumeratorBase<'Value>
    interface IEnumerator<'Value>
Public Class DequeEnumerator(Of TValue)
Inherits DequeEnumeratorBase(Of TValue)
Implements IEnumerator(Of TValue)

Parametry typu

TValue

Typ elementu v řízené sekvenci

Dědičnost
DequeEnumerator<TValue>
Implementuje

Poznámky

Některé metody, především operátory, deklarují typ parametru, ale neurčují název parametru. Takový parametr se označuje jako nepojmenovaný parametr. V dokumentaci k těmto metodám představuje zástupný symbol A_0 nepojmenovaný parametr.

Konstruktory

DequeEnumerator<TValue>(IDeque<TValue>, Int32)

Přidělí a inicializuje nový DequeEnumerator<TValue> objekt.

Vlastnosti

Current

Získá nebo nastaví aktuální prvek v kolekci.

Metody

Dispose()

Uvolní, uvolní nebo resetuje nespravované prostředky, které objekt používá DequeEnumerator<TValue> .

Dispose(Boolean)

Uvolní, uvolní nebo resetuje nespravované prostředky, které objekt používá DequeEnumerator<TValue> .

Equals(Object)

Určí, zda se zadaný objekt rovná aktuálnímu objektu.

(Zděděno od Object)
GetHashCode()

Slouží jako výchozí hashovací funkce.

(Zděděno od Object)
GetType()

Získá aktuální Type instanci.

(Zděděno od Object)
MemberwiseClone()

Vytvoří mělkou kopii aktuálního Objectsouboru .

(Zděděno od Object)
MoveNext()

Posune enumerátor na další prvek v kolekci.

Reset()

Nastaví enumerátor na počáteční pozici, která je před prvním prvkem v kolekci.

ToString()

Vrátí řetězec, který představuje aktuální objekt.

(Zděděno od Object)

Platí pro